Transaction fb6f666ae69883b8cc33b24c32037339a50dcd7cf628e0eaa4fbc570e9db5b83
1 Input
1 Output
-
fb6f666ae69883b8cc33b24c32037339a50dcd7cf628e0eaa4fbc570e9db5b83:0
- value
- 93365
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9a27aa89649cd393c8cf28322497d63258fbcfc
- address
- bc1qax3842ykf8xnj0yv72pjyjtavvjcl08upgh7s9